Recognizing Coffee Beans: Types and Selections



When diving right into the world of coffee, comprehending the types and selections of coffee beans is vital for every fanatic. You'll mainly come across two main types: Arabica and Robusta. Arabica beans are recognized for their smooth, complicated tastes and reduced caffeine content, making them a favored amongst coffee enthusiasts. On the other hand, Robusta beans load a punch with a more powerful, more bitter taste and greater caffeine degrees, frequently made use of in espresso blends.Within these types, you'll locate various local varieties, each bringing special features. Ethiopian Yirgacheffe uses bright floral notes, while Colombian beans supply a healthy taste account. As you explore, keep in mind to take notice of processing techniques like cleaned or all-natural, as they can significantly influence the last taste. Handling Techniques Explained



The following crucial action is refining them to change those vivid fruits right into the beans you'll brew once you've harvested your coffee cherries. There are two main methods: the wet procedure and the dry process. In the dry process, you spread the cherries out in the sunlight to completely dry, enabling the fruit to ferment and give distinct flavors to the beans. On the various other hand, the damp process includes removing the fruit promptly and fermenting the beans in water, leading to a cleaner taste. After processing, the beans are hulled, arranged, and normally dried out once more. Each technique affects the taste account, so try out both can assist you uncover your preferred brew. Roast Levels Clarified



Roast degrees play a necessary role in forming the flavor account of your coffee. You'll appreciate bright level of acidity and fruity notes when you choose a light roast. As you move to a tool roast, you'll see a balance of sweet taste and complexity, commonly highlighting chocolate or sugar flavors. Dark roasts, on the various other hand, supply bold, great smoky characteristics with less level of acidity, making them robust and abundant. Each degree results from various roasting times and temperatures, impacting the beans' chemical make-up. By understanding these levels, you can much better pick a coffee that matches your taste preferences. Flavor Growth Process



As you check out the taste development process, you'll discover that toasting techniques play a critical role in forming the preference profile of your coffee. The toasting temperature level and time directly influence the level of acidity, sweetness, and anger of the beans. Light roasts keep more of the bean's initial flavors, highlighting floral and fruity notes. Tool roasts balance acidity and body, using an all-around flavor. Dark roasts, on the various other hand, highlight bold, great smoky qualities while reducing the bean's intrinsic high qualities. During toasting, chain reactions, like the Maillard response and caramelization, transform the beans and improve their intricacy. Espresso vs. Blended Coffee: Secret Distinctions



Coffee and combined coffee each deal one-of-a-kind experiences that deal with various preferences and preferences. Espresso is a concentrated coffee made by forcing warm water through finely-ground coffee beans, resulting in an abundant, vibrant taste and a luscious layer of crema ahead. It's frequently delighted in as a shot or used as a base for drinks like cappucinos and cappuccinos.On the other hand, mixed coffee integrates various beans from different areas, developing an extra balanced taste account. You'll commonly discover blends that highlight sweetness, acidity, or body, making them flexible for different developing approaches. While espresso focuses on strength, combined coffee might use a wider variety of tastes that can alter with each sip.Ultimately, your option between coffee and blended coffee boils down to your personal preference. Tips for Selecting and Keeping Coffee Beans



Selecting and saving coffee beans appropriately can substantially enhance your brewing experience. Beginning by selecting high-grade beans that match your taste. Try to find freshness; beans baked within the last 2 weeks are optimal. Check the roast day on the packaging, and acquire from trustworthy roasters or regional shops.Once you have your beans, keep them in an airtight container to website here stop exposure to air, light, and wetness. A dark, awesome area works best, so prevent maintaining them in the fridge or fridge freezer, as this can present moisture. Just grind the quantity you need to keep quality; whole beans maintain taste longer than pre-ground coffee.Lastly, attempt to use your beans within 2 to 4 weeks after opening for peak taste.
